"Keep a food diary; any small notebook will work. Writing down everything you eat and drink not only makes you more cognizant of your daily calorie intake, it becomes a tangible record of how and when you are consuming food (afternoon snacks, late-night pantry raids). The diary can be as detailed or as brief as you choose to make it. It also helps to remind you that every day is a new page and a 'fresh start.'"
